From 082ae3df0b9dd759d56684b0221df62ea171f8ec Mon Sep 17 00:00:00 2001 From: polo Date: Tue, 30 May 2023 23:19:28 +0200 Subject: bouton partager pour visiteurs --- "cat\303\251gories disco m\303\251laine.txt" | 50 ++++++++++++++++++++++++++++ controller/admin.php | 2 ++ controller/config.php | 5 +-- controller/visitor.php | 2 ++ view/album.php | 17 ++++++---- view/articlesContent.php | 28 +++++++++++----- view/template-formulaires.php | 8 ----- "\303\240 faire apr\303\250s livraison.txt" | 8 +++++ 8 files changed, 94 insertions(+), 26 deletions(-) create mode 100644 "cat\303\251gories disco m\303\251laine.txt" diff --git "a/cat\303\251gories disco m\303\251laine.txt" "b/cat\303\251gories disco m\303\251laine.txt" new file mode 100644 index 0000000..ffea6dd --- /dev/null +++ "b/cat\303\251gories disco m\303\251laine.txt" @@ -0,0 +1,50 @@ +en route pour la gloire +route 29 +route 66 +Remière trilogie +Kan tri Men +Kan Tri  + +Albums personnels +Emoi des mots +Hey!Ho! +Nos îles, nos amours +Présent d’exil +La chambre +Melaine +Au secret déluge chansons simples et chants de longue haleine +Petit Garçon Chante, chante +Basse danse +Du bon côté Compil l’Oz +Eliz Isa Les grandes voix de Bretagne +Fip flop chut +levée en masse +Dan ar Braz + +interprétés par ou avec d’autres +Marche à mer +Anthologie Bagadou +Diaouled ar Menez +Chants de marins L’île de Batz +Marche à mer Kevrenn st Mark +Afrojig   Kevrenn st Mark +Bagad Ronsed mor + +Anthologie de la chanson française +Good Bye Gagarine - G.Pierron +Le plus bel âge - Duo Tanghe Coudroy +Les blés sur l’eau G.Yacoub +Amours que j’ai Roulez fillettes  +La Mirlitantouille +Plage - Biniou Braz Patrick Molard +le plus bel äge-  La compagnie du beau temps +Au bout du vent Enez Eussa +Ne t’approche pas comme ça-  Barbara d’Alcantara +Chanson pour Marinette TSF +Blanche Rowen et Mike Gulston Sorta Kinda + +Illustrations de pochettes +ça tourne toujours  +Hop là! +Bagad Kemperle ( préface livret) + diff --git a/controller/admin.php b/controller/admin.php index 038d4c3..21a8f6f 100644 --- a/controller/admin.php +++ b/controller/admin.php @@ -169,6 +169,8 @@ function legalEdit($fileCode, int $suppression) function albumEdit($fileCode, int $suppression) { $page = $_GET['page']; + $lien_partage = 'index.php?page=' . $page . '&file_code=' . $fileCode; + global $host; $title = "Discographie"; // modèle diff --git a/controller/config.php b/controller/config.php index 067d89b..6fc7000 100644 --- a/controller/config.php +++ b/controller/config.php @@ -12,8 +12,9 @@ $storage = 'files'; // laisser 'files'!! // l'utilisation d'une BDD n'est pas prévue pour l'instant -// Racine du site (inutile pour l'instant) +// Racine du site //$root = getcwd(); +//$root = 'http://' . $_SERVER['DOCUMENT_ROOT']; // nom de domaine (utilisé pour créer des liens absolus) // depuis une fonction, faire un: 'global $host;' @@ -46,7 +47,7 @@ else // conversion des 2M du php.ini en 2000000 -// les kibi, mébi et gibi sont inutiles ici +// note: les kibi, mébi et gibi sont inutiles ici function returnBytes ($size_str) // chaine du style '2M' { switch (substr ($size_str, -1)) diff --git a/controller/visitor.php b/controller/visitor.php index 92f3db7..477ef77 100644 --- a/controller/visitor.php +++ b/controller/visitor.php @@ -163,6 +163,8 @@ function discoVisitor() function albumVisitor($fileCode) { $page = $_GET['page']; + $lien_partage = 'index.php?page=' . $page . '&file_code=' . $fileCode; + global $host; $Albums = new Album($page, 'discographie'); $Albums->getAllJSON(); diff --git a/view/album.php b/view/album.php index 795491d..f8879aa 100644 --- a/view/album.php +++ b/view/album.php @@ -84,18 +84,19 @@ else ?>

+ @@ -104,8 +105,10 @@ if($_SESSION['admin'] == 1 && (!isset($_GET['action']) || $_GET['action'] !== 'e +

fileListCount; $i++)
> fileList[$i]['fileCode']; + global $host; + // remplacer un article par l'éditeur if($_SESSION['admin'] == 1 && isset($_GET['action']) && $_GET['action'] == 'editor' && isset($_GET['file_code']) && $_GET['file_code'] == $Articles->fileList[$i]['fileCode'] @@ -72,6 +74,15 @@ for($i = 0; $i < $Articles->fileListCount; $i++)

Modification d'un article

+
+

+ + + + +

+fileListCount; $i++) { // et voila echo($Articles->fileList[$i]['content'] . "\n"); - - // bouton - if($_SESSION['admin'] == 1) - { - $lien_partage = 'index.php?page=' . $page . '#' . $Articles->fileList[$i]['fileCode']; - global $host; - ?> +?>

+ @@ -109,7 +119,7 @@ for($i = 0; $i < $Articles->fileListCount; $i++)

- diff --git a/view/template-formulaires.php b/view/template-formulaires.php index 8c1d161..0ffbba3 100644 --- a/view/template-formulaires.php +++ b/view/template-formulaires.php @@ -55,14 +55,6 @@ if($page === 'discographie' || $page === 'album') - - -